- /**********Nokia 5110 LCD 顯示程序***************/
- /**********作者:鄭文 ***************/
- /**********芯片:AT89S52 **************/
- /*功能:支持中文顯示、字符顯示、圖片顯示********/
- #include <reg52.h>
- #include <intrins.h>
- #include "english_6x8_pixel.h"
- #include "picture84x48.h"
- #include "Nokia_5110.h"
- #include "18b20.h"
- #define uchar unsigned char
- #define uint unsigned int
- uchar tem_h,tem_l,tem_f,tem_f1,tem_f2;
- uint tem; //溫度讀取后*10后存儲空間地址
- float tem_read; //溫度讀取保存地址空間
- void Delay1ms(unsigned int count);
- void temperature_read_charge(void);
- void nokia_5110_picture();//寫一屏圖
- /************毫秒延時(shí)程序********************/
- void Delay1ms(unsigned int count)
- {
- unsigned int i,j;
- for(i=0;i<count;i++)
- for(j=0;j<120;j++);
- }
- /********************************************/
- /*void temperature_read_charge(void)
- {
-
- tem_read=ReadTemperature();
- tem=tem_read*1000; //溫度精確到小數(shù)點(diǎn)后3位
- tem_h=tem/10000+0x30; //溫度高位
- tem_l=( tem-(tem_h-0x30)*10000 )/1000+0x30; //溫度低位
- tem_f=( tem-(tem_h-0x30)*10000-(tem_l-0x30)*1000 )/100+0x30;
- tem_f1=( tem-(tem_h-0x30)*10000-(tem_l-0x30)*1000-(tem_f-0x30)*100 )/10+0x30;
- tem_f2=( tem-(tem_h-0x30)*10000-(tem_l-0x30)*1000-(tem_f-0x30)*100-(tem_f1-0x30)*10 )+0x30;
- Delay1ms(100);
- }
- */
- /**********************************************/
- void nokia_5110_picture()//寫一屏圖
- {
- uchar e;
- uchar t;
- uchar k;
- uint d;
- d=0;
- for(t=0;t<6;t++)
- {
- for(k=0;k<84;k++)
- {
- e=dal[d];
- write_byte(e,1);
- d=d+1;
- }
- }
- }
